Armed Forces Medical College (AFMC) conducts a national level entrance test for the selection of candidates to the MBBS course. Exam centers would be in major cities like Kolkota, Chennai, Bangalore, Mumbai, Pune, etc. Exams center can be chosen by the candidate according to their convenience and preference. This must be done at the time of submission of application, in which one can give three different choices of exam centers. AFMC examination question paper covers the areas of Biology Physics and Chemistry.
